Night hike through Sodalis Nature Preserve planned for May 27

Hannibal Parks and Recreation

HANNIBAL, Mo. — Hannibal Parks & Recreation is sponsoring a night hike through Sodalis Nature Preserve from 7:30 to 9:30 p.m. Friday, May 27. The program, which follows a two-mile paved trail, is led by certified nature educator Gale Rublee.

Participants may stay with the group or return to the parking lot on their own. Activities include seasonal observations, sensory activities and the telling of the creation of Sodalis Nature Preserve.

Hannibal Parks & Recreation nature programs are free, but reservations must be made by contacting Mary Lynne Richards at 573-221-0154 or mlrichards@hannibal-mo.gov.

Rublee is a nationally certified interpreter guide with more than 30 years of experience as a nature educator and storyteller. She is a founding member of the Mississippi Hills Missouri Master Naturalist Chapter in Hannibal.
